Primary Cerebellar Agenesis – Chiari Iv Malformation

Authors : D TEKİN, S UYSAL, Ö İYİGÜN

Abstract :Total or subtotal cerebellar agenesis that was described firstly by M. Combettes in 1831 is very rare. Severe dysfunction in movement is observed in the cerebellar lesions. Since there is a significant recovery in movement partial cerebellum lesions, it has been suggested that normal movement is not absolute dependent to cerebellum. But this issue is still controversial. The cases of complete cerebellar agenesis in the literature are usually reported in the autopsy. The study presented here is the sixth living case in the literature according to our knowledge.
